Feeling disoriented is a state of mental confusion where an individual may have difficulty understanding their surroundings, time, or personal identity. This sensation of disorientation can manifest as a loss of spatial awareness, an inability to focus or concentrate, or a sense of being disconnected from reality. It can affect one's ability to perform daily tasks and make decisions, often leading to a heightened sense of distress or anxiety. Several causes can contribute to feelings of disorientation. Acute causes include sudden changes in environment, such as moving to a new location or experiencing extreme stress or trauma. Medical conditions such as low blood sugar (hypoglycemia), dehydration, or vestibular disorders affecting balance can also lead to disorientation. Neurological conditions, including transient ischemic attacks (TIAs), strokes, or epilepsy, can cause sudden and severe disorientation. Additionally, certain medications, especially those with sedative effects or interactions, may impair cognitive functions and contribute to feelings of disorientation. Chronic conditions like dementia or delirium can cause persistent disorientation, affecting an individual's cognitive abilities over time.
Treatment for disorientation depends on its underlying cause. For acute or situational disorientation, addressing the immediate factors, such as ensuring adequate hydration and nutrition, reducing stress, or providing a stable environment, can be effective. If a medical condition is the root cause, appropriate treatment or management of the condition is crucial. In cases where medications are involved, adjusting dosages or switching to alternative treatments may be necessary. For chronic disorientation, especially due to neurological or cognitive disorders, a comprehensive approach including medication, therapy, and support services is essential for improving quality of life and managing symptoms.
